A blue square showing two white cyclists side by side, seen from the front.

On a road with this sign, my friend and I rode our bicycles two abreast.

この標識のある道路で、友人と普通自転車で二台並んで走った。

This statement is TRUE

Explanation

This is correct. Where the side-by-side sign is posted, standard bicycles may ride up to two abreast — never three or more.

About this sign

Name
Riding two abreast permitted並進可
What it means
Allows two ordinary bicycles to ride side by side.

Original text

交通法第六十三条の五の道路標識により、普通自転車が他の普通自転車と並進(三台以上並進することとなる場合を除く。以下この項において同じ。)することができることとすること。

Source: Order on Road Signs, Road Lines and Road Markings — 道路標識、区画線及び道路標示に関する命令 別表第一(第二条関係) 並進可(四〇一) · Prime Minister's Office / Ministry of Construction Order No.3 of 1960
